Nigerian delegation inks MoU with iNDEXTb

The visiting delegation of Nigeria today inked a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the state-run business promotion agency iNDEXTb to explore bilateral investment and trade opportunities.

The MoU was signed between Managing Director of Industrial Extension Bureau (iNDEXTb) Bhagyesh Jha, and Executive secretary of  Nigerian Investment Promotion Commission(NIPC), Mustafa Bello.

While briefing the Nigerian delegation Principal Secretary, Industries and Mines, M M Sahu said, "Once the tri-partied institutional framework format of the Nigerian High Commission, the CII and iDEXTb is in place, we could explore the possibilities in areas like Oil and Gas, Education, Minerals, IT and SME sector."

Bello showed keen interest in adopting the state model of development back home in Nigeria.

"With a customer base of 360 million, the high commission of Nigeria is willing to enter into capacity building programmes to access the benefits of academic excellence,"
